#29064b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#29064b is composed of 16.1% red, 2.4%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.3% cyan, 92%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 270.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 15.9%. #29064b color hex could be obtained by blending #520c96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#29064b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f7effe is the lightest one.

Tones of #29064b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292829 is the less saturated color, while #29034e is the most saturated one.
